Respiratory Pathogen Panel TEM-PCR (Viracor)

Message
This assay detects respiratory Coronaviruses only.  This assay does NOT detect if the patient is positive for the novel 2019
Coronavirus.

Preferred Specimen
Specimen types include:  BAL, Bronch Wash, Nasal aspirate, Nasal Swab, Nasal Wash, NP Aspirate, NP wash, NP swab, throat gargle,
tracheal aspirate, tracheal wash and sputum.
NOTE:  Nasopharyngeal (NP) swabs are no longer an acceptable specimen for NLR only.
 


Minimum Volume
Nasal swab and NP swab: 2 mL
All other specimen types: 0.5 mL


Instructions
For fluids: Collect in a sterile, screw top tube.
For swabs: Place sterile swab in 2 mL sterile saline, M4, or viral transport media in a sterile screw top tube.
Do not use calcium alginate swab or wood shafted swab.


Transport Temperature
Frozen


Specimen Stability
Room Temperature: 7 days
Refrigerated: 7 days
Frozen: 30 days


Reject Criteria (Eg, hemolysis? Lipemia? Thaw/Other?)
Wood shafted swab, calcium alginate swab, specimens received in trap containers, specimens received beyond their acceptable length of time from collection.
